talkSPORT's Gabby Agbonlahor took very little time to mock Arsenal after their Premier League title chances were dealt a massive blow.

The Aston Villa legend watched his beloved club beat the Gunners 2-0 thanks to late goals from Leon Bailey and Ollie Watkins.

Villa shocked the title race with a huge win away at ArsenalCredit: Getty

It's a result that sees Villa go fourth in the Premier League but keeps Arsenal second and two points adrift of leaders Manchester City.

Mikel Arteta's side had the chance to take the title race into their own hands but failed to do so, which caused Agbonlahor to rejoice in their misery.

Shortly after full-time, he went live on his Instagram account while sat in his living room, with Sky Sports showing the results on his TV.

In the background, the song North London Forever could be heard playing through Agbonlahor's speakers.

The anthem, written by Gunners fan Louis Dunford, was released in 2022 and is now played pre-match at the Emirates Stadium.

But Agbonlahor, who scored 86 goals for Villa, didn't sing in unison with Arsenal supporters and instead mocked them after a bitter defeat.

"North London forever, whatever the weather," he could be heard signing before bursting into laughter, and then going: "Woohoo!"

Villa's win was their second against Arsenal this season and saw the Gunners fall to defeat in the league for the first time in 2024.
